BoltAI 智能数据库开发助手:重塑数据库开发模式
BoltAI 智能数据库开发助手:重塑数据库开发模式
数据库作为企业数据管理的核心,其开发效率与准确性至关重要。JBoltAI 推出的智能数据库开发助手,基于先进的 AI 技术,为开发人员和数据库管理人员提供了创新的解决方案。
一、核心功能与应用场景
(一)自然语言驱动的表结构设计
通过自然语言交互,用户只需描述业务需求(如 “创建企业 ERP 系统中财务管理的资金流水表”),助手即可自动生成对应的表结构。以“资金流水表(fin_fund_flow)” 为例,系统可精准识别字段类型(如 bigint、varchar)、长度、约束条件(非空、主键),并生成中文注释,大幅降低手动设计的复杂度。
(二)动态修改与版本管理
支持对已有表结构进行实时调整。例如用户针对 “销售线索表(crm_lead)” 提出 “删除联系邮箱字段” 的需求,助手可即时响应并更新表结构,同时保留历史记录(如 “Tables 历史记录” 功能),方便开发团队追溯和管理版本变更。
(三)自动化 DDL 语句生成
基于生成的表结构,助手可直接输出标准的 DDL(数据定义语言)语句。以 “销售线索表” 为例,系统生成的 CREATE TABLE 语句包含字段定义、注释及约束条件(如 AUTO_INCREMENT、DEFAULT NULL),开发人员可直接复制使用,减少手动编写代码的错误率。

二、技术架构与实现逻辑
(一)技术栈与核心组件
- 基座:基于 JBoltAI SpringBoot 版开发框架,确保系统稳定性与兼容性。
- AI 能力层:整合大模型 API(LLM)、思维链(COT)技术,实现自然语言到结构化数据的解析(Text2Json、Text2Sql)。
- 交互层:提供可视化界面,支持用户输入需求、查看历史记录及导出设计成果。
(二)工作流程解析
- 需求输入:用户通过文本框输入自然语言需求(如 “设计学生信息表”)。
- 语义解析:大模型通过 COT 思维链拆解需求,识别实体(如 “学生信息”)、属性(如 “姓名”“联系方式”)及业务规则(如 “主键 ID 自增”)。
- 结构生成:生成 JSON 格式的表结构数据,并映射为可视化表格。
- DDL 输出:根据表结构自动生成 SQL 语句,支持一键复制。
三、实际价值与行业意义
- 减少手动劳动:避免传统开发中手动设计表结构和编写 DDL 的繁琐流程,可节省开发时间。
- 降低错误率:通过 AI 自动校验字段约束(如非空、数据类型匹配),减少因人为疏忽导致的设计缺陷。
- 降低技术门槛:即使是非专业数据库工程师,也可通过自然语言快速完成表设计,推动中小企业数字化转型。
四、总结与展望
JBoltAI 智能数据库开发助手通过 “自然语言交互 + AI 自动化生成” 的模式,重新定义了数据库开发流程。其核心价值在于将技术门槛降低、效率提升与标准化结合,适用于软件开发团队、企业 IT 部门及教育科研等场景。未来,随着 AI 技术的深入发展,此类工具或将进一步整合数据建模、性能优化等功能,推动数据库开发向全生命周期智能化演进。

浙公网安备 33010602011771号